A long drought will be broken one way or another as the 2018 Big Six Championship Final gets underway between the Carnduff Red Devils and Redvers Rockets.

The Best-of-7 Final begins Wednesday, March 14th with the top two teams in the regular season going head-to-head hoping to raise the Lincoln Memorial Trophy over their heads in the next two weeks.

Season Series:

Carnduff won all three games against Redvers this season to sweep the season series, with all three games played before Christmas. Carnduff won by a combined total of 17-5. (5-1 on Nov. 8th, 7-2 on Dec. 3rd, 5-2 on Dec. 22nd)

How They Got Here:

The regular season champions from Carnduff defeated the Carlyle Cougars (2-0) in the Best-of-3 quarterfinal round, winning 6-2 in Carnduff and 4-1 in Carlyle. Carnduff then knocked off the back-to-back league champion Wawota Flyers, going the distance in the Best-of-5 Semi-Final. (4-0 Carnduff, 4-1 Wawota, 5-1 Carnduff, 5-3 Wawota, 4-1 Carnduff)

The Redvers Rockets dispatched of the Oxbow Huskies (2-0) in the Best-of-3 quarterfinal round, winning 9-3 in Redvers and 7-1 in Oxbow. The Rockets then swept away the Bienfait Coalers in three straight games in the Best-of-5 semi-final round, winning 6-4, 3-0 and 5-2

Last Playoff Meeting

These two teams met in the Big Six quarterfinal just three seasons ago in 2014/15. That year, Carnduff swept Redvers in three straight games (4-2, 3-1, 6-1) before falling to the Wawota Flyers in the semi-final round.

Championship Drought

Both teams will look to bring a Big Six championship banner to their town for the first time in a while.

Carnduff last won a Big Six title in 2006/07, defeating the Carlyle Cougars in overtime of Game 7 that season. That remains the last year Carnduff has made the final round, with the Red Devils having won 10 league titles in team history.

Redvers last appeared in the championship final in 2008/09, bowing out in five games that season to the Midale Mustangs. Redvers and Oxbow are the only two teams in the Big Six (not counting Yellow Grass) to have never won a Big Six title in team history.
